The Influence of Head and Neck Position on Performance of Ambu AuraGainTM in Children

Detailed Summary

The influence of different head and neck positions on the effectiveness of ventilation with the Ambu AuraGain airway remains unevaluated. This study aimed to evaluate the influence of different head and neck positions on ventilation with the AuraGain airway. An AuraGain will be placed in all patients, and mechanical ventilation will be performed using a volume-controlled mode with a tidal volume of 10 ml/kg. The expiratory tidal volume, peak inspiratory pressure, oropharyngeal leak pressure, and ventilation score will be assessed first for the neutral head position and then for the extended, flexed, and rotated head positions in a random order.
